A *Notes*: -1) **Leap seconds**: Slots will last `SECONDS_PER_SLOT + 1` or `SECONDS_PER_SLOT - 1` seconds around leap seconds. +1) **Leap seconds**: Slots will last `SECONDS_PER_SLOT + 1` or `SECONDS_PER_SLOT - 1` seconds around leap seconds. This is automatically handled by [UNIX time](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Unix_time). 2) **Honest clocks**: Honest nodes are assumed to have clocks synchronized within `SECONDS_PER_SLOT` seconds of each other. 3) **Eth1 data**: The large `ETH1_FOLLOW_DISTANCE` specified in the [honest validator document](https://github.com/ethereum/eth2.0-specs/blob/dev/specs/validator/0_beacon-chain-validator.md) should ensure that `state.latest_eth1_data` of the canonical Ethereum 2.0 chain remains consistent with the canonical Ethereum 1.0 chain. If not, emergency manual intervention will be required. 4) **Manual forks**: Manual forks may arbitrarily change the fork choice rule but are expected to be enacted at epoch transitions, with the fork details reflected in `state.fork`. +5) **Implementation**: The implementation found in this specification is constructed for ease of understanding rather than for optimization in computation, space, or any other resource.
